    Naoe is the ultimate authentic Japanese culinary experience, in a very intimate setting, where the master chef Kevin Cory, hostess Wendy and two waitresses serve prix fixe meal to lucky eight patrons. What you WON'T find here are the familiar quasi-Japanese fares like California rolls, Teriyaki, shrimp tempuras and fake wasabi. Instead, you will be treated with smorgasbord of delectable treats, some delightfully foreign (and some challenging), like sea bass porridge, sea urchin eggs, and soy sauce sorbet. Monsieur Kory is our equivalent of Japan's octogenarian sushi master Jiro Ono, whose exploits have been famously documented in the documentary, "Jiro Dreams of Sushi". For the true Sushi connoisseurs, it will definitely prove worth your while to find this little, concealed spot in Brickell Key.

    You know the restaurant is like no other when you are part of only eight fellow diners. If you are seated at the sushi bar, you can watch Executive Chef Kevin Cory doing what he does best – creating bite-size morsels of the most extraordinary sushi ever assembled. Dinner is “omakase” (chef’s choice), one amazing course after another composed of the freshest ingredients from all over the world, best accompanied by superb sake from Chef Cory’s family brewery in Western Japan. $$$$$.
